Dietary fats may affect the risk of developing type 2 diabetes
For the prevention of type 2 diabetes, it is not the total amount of fat consumed that is crucial, but rather its quality composition. The study focuses on the mechanisms of action of two main fatty acids: palmitic acid (saturated) and oleic acid (monounsaturated). It has been established that these compounds have opposite effects on insulin sensitivity and overall metabolic processes.
Palmitic acid, which is widely present in food products, is classified by researchers as a risk factor for the development of metabolic pathologies. At the molecular level, it initiates the accumulation of potentially toxic bioactive lipids and provokes the development of low-intensity chronic inflammation. The authors pay special attention to the destructive effects of this acid on cellular organelles, as it causes dysfunction of mitochondria and the endoplasmic reticulum. These processes lead to impaired insulin action and contribute to the progression of diabetes.
Oleic acid, the main source of which is olive oil, demonstrates a pronounced protective profile. Unlike palmitic acid, it promotes the storage of lipids in metabolically inert forms, which minimizes their impact on physiological functions. Oleic acid helps maintain proper insulin signaling in key tissues such as the liver, muscles, and adipose tissue. Additionally, it can neutralize many of the side effects caused by excessive saturated fats.
These findings explain the high effectiveness of the Mediterranean diet, which is rich in monounsaturated fats, in reducing the risk of developing type 2 diabetes. The researchers emphasize the need for a shift towards more precise nutritional strategies. When assessing the impact of fats on health, it is important to consider not only their type, but also their origin, dietary context, interactions with other nutrients, and cooking methods. Further research in this area will contribute to the development of more effective methods for preventing and managing metabolic diseases.
